Is it true that the skin on your lips the same as?

Lip "skin" is different

The lips' structure is actually different than other skin. As shown in the diagram to the right, lips do not have the same protective outer layer, or stratum corneum, found in other skin; nor do lips have the same amount of oil and sweat glands.

Why are lips a different color than skin?

The thin stratum corneum (which is thinner on our lips than anywhere else on our body) and the lack of melanin in the lips, allows underlying red blood-vessels and capillaries to be more apparent. This my friends, is why our lips are a different colour than the rest of our skin.

Is the skin on your lips the same as your face?

The skin on your lips is different from the rest of your body because it is thinner and more delicate. Skin on your face can be up to 16 cell layers thick while the skin on your lips is only 3 to 5 layers thick. This means your blood vessels are more apparent, giving your lips their pink or red colour.

What determines lip color?

The skin on your lips lacks the skin cells called melanocytes that produce pigment. That's why the blood vessels in your lip appear more prominently. The vermilion of your lips can range in color from reddish-pink to brown.

Why are my lips black?

Causes of dark lips

Darkening of the lips can be the result of hyperpigmentation. This is a typically harmless condition caused by an excess of melanin. Lip hyperpigmentation may be caused by: excessive exposure to the sun.

Why are my lips so white?

White lips

This is usually caused by anemia, which is a low red blood cell count. Anemia that causes pale or white lips is severe and requires immediate medical attention. Any of the following may lead to anemia: a diet low in iron.

What are those balls in your lips?

What are mucous cysts? A mucous cyst, also known as a mucocele, is a fluid-filled swelling that occurs on the lip or the mouth. The cyst develops when the mouth's salivary glands become plugged with mucus. Most cysts are on the lower lip, but they can occur anywhere inside your mouth.

Why are my lips naturally pink?

The short answer? You basically have more blood vessels in your lips, said Braverman. The waterproof protective layer of your skin, the stratum corneum, is really thin on your lips, which makes it a lot easier to see your red blood vessels.

Are hotdogs made of lips?

It's true that skin, fat and gristly parts (like, well, lips) can be used in a mechanically separated slurry, but the USDA only allows a hot dog to be made with 20 percent or less mechanically separated pork. That means there's just not much in the way of snouts or lips to be had.
